In order to replace the Harmonic Balancer, the first step is to disconnect the negative
Battery Cable. Release accessory
Drive Belt tensioner and remove the Drive Belt from the engine. Next, pull out and relocate the most critical module -- the electronic brake control module, from the bracket, the power steering gear and the
Starter motor will also be removed. Remove Power Steering Cooler bolts from the front crossmember, remove the function of power steering and reposition it. Loosen the air conditioning(T/C) belt tensioner and deglue a/c Drive Belt off the engine. Next, take out the Harmonic Balancer. To get started with the installation, install the first Harmonic Balancer, then the a/c Drive Belt to the engine and then the power steering gear followed by Power Steering Cooler to the front cross member. Secure the Power Steering Cooler bolts with 11 nm (97 inch lbs). The next thing is to install the Starter motor, lower the vehicle, and install the accessory Drive Belt to the engine. Re-attach the electronic brake control module to the bracket and then reconnect the negative Battery Cable, securing the negative Battery Cable bolt at 15 nm (11 ft. Lbs.). Finally, program the transmitters.
